The Witch’s Brew Latte

Kickstart your Halloween morning with a bewitching brew.

A. Ingredients

  • Dark roast coffee
  • Activated charcoal (for color)
  • Vanilla syrup
  • Frothy milk
  • Black sugar crystals (for garnish)

B. Brewing Process

  1. Brew a strong cup of dark roast coffee.
  2. Add a pinch of activated charcoal for that eerie black hue.
  3. Sweeten it with a splash of vanilla syrup.
  4. Top it off with frothy milk and a sprinkle of black sugar crystals.

Pumpkin Spice Screamuccino

Get ready to howl with delight!

A. Ingredients

  • Espresso or strong brewed coffee
  • Pumpkin puree
  • Pumpkin spice mix
  • Whipped cream
  • Cinnamon sticks (for garnish)

B. Brewing Process

  1. Brew a shot of espresso or a strong cup of coffee.
  2. Blend in some pumpkin puree and a dash of pumpkin spice mix.
  3. Top it with a generous dollop of whipped cream.
  4. Garnish with a cinnamon stick for a spine-chilling effect.

Mocha Monster Madness

For all the chocoholics out there.

A. Ingredients

  • Espresso or brewed coffee
  • Hot chocolate mix
  • Marshmallows
  • Chocolate syrup
  • Candy eyeballs (for garnish)

B. Brewing Process

  1. Brew a fresh cup of espresso or coffee.
  2. Stir in a spoonful of hot chocolate mix.
  3. Top it with marshmallows and a drizzle of chocolate syrup.
  4. Add candy eyeballs to give it that eerie monster look.

Spiced Vampire Cold Brew

Chill out with this blood-red concoction.

A. Ingredients

  • Cold brew coffee
  • Pomegranate juice
  • Cinnamon sticks
  • Edible glitter (for garnish)

B. Brewing Process

  1. Prepare a glass of cold brew coffee.
  2. Mix in some pomegranate juice for that blood-red hue.
  3. Add a cinnamon stick for a hint of spice.
  4. Sprinkle edible glitter to make it sparkle like vampire skin.

Zombie Caramel Macchiato

Wake the undead with this caramel-infused delight.

A. Ingredients

  • Espresso
  • Caramel syrup
  • Milk
  • Green apple slices (for garnish)
  • Crushed graham crackers (for garnish)

B. Brewing Process

  1. Brew a shot of espresso.
  2. Sweeten it with caramel syrup.
  3. Steam the milk and froth it.
  4. Pour the milk over the espresso.
  5. Garnish with green apple slices and crushed graham crackers.

Haunted Hazelnut Mocha

A spooky twist on a classic favorite.

A. Ingredients

  • Hazelnut-flavored coffee
  • Cocoa powder
  • Whipped cream
  • Chocolate shavings (for garnish)

B. Brewing Process

  1. Brew a cup of hazelnut-flavored coffee.
  2. Add a touch of cocoa powder for a hauntingly rich taste.
  3. Top it off with whipped cream and chocolate shavings.

Ghostly Cinnamon Vanilla Latte

A comforting concoction with a spectral touch.

A. Ingredients

  • Espresso or brewed coffee
  • Cinnamon syrup
  • Vanilla extract
  • Whipped cream
  • Cinnamon dust (for garnish)

B. Brewing Process

  1. Brew a shot of espresso or a cup of coffee.
  2. Infuse it with cinnamon syrup and a drop of vanilla extract.
  3. Finish with a dollop of whipped cream and a sprinkle of cinnamon dust.

FAQs about Spooky Coffee

Q1. Can I use decaf coffee for these recipes?

Absolutely! You can substitute decaf coffee in any of these spooky coffee creations.

    Q2. Where can I find edible glitter for the Vampire Cold Brew?

    Edible glitter is available at most baking supply stores and online retailers.

    Q3. Can I make these recipes dairy-free?

    Yes, you can use dairy-free alternatives like almond or coconut milk for a vegan twist.

    Q4. Do these drinks contain a lot of sugar?

    The sweetness level can be adjusted to your preference by altering the amount of syrup or sugar used.

    Q5. Are these recipes suitable for kids?

    Some of them can be enjoyed by kids, but you may want to skip the coffee and opt for decaffeinated versions for the little ones.
